Cold Mix Asphalt Vs. Hot Mix Asphalt: Which Is Right for You?

Structure Distinctions
Cold mix asphalt is generated by emulsifying the asphalt binder with water and an emulsifying agent before blending it with aggregate. The warm mix asphalt production procedure entails heating up the aggregate and asphalt binder individually prior to integrating them at the asphalt plant.
Moreover, cold mix asphalt often tends to be much less dense and a lot more flexible than warm mix asphalt. This flexibility makes it far better fit for locations with higher levels of activity, such as driveways or roadways with heavy web traffic. On the other hand, warm mix asphalt is recognized for its high toughness and resistance to rutting and splitting, making it a preferred option for highways and high-traffic roadways where long life is vital.
Installment Refine Variations
The process of installing cold mix and hot mix asphalt displays noteworthy variations in their treatments and demands. Cold mix asphalt, being a much more versatile product, can be applied straight from the bag or container onto the fracture or harmed area. It requires minimal preparation work, such as cleansing the area and compacting the cool blend with hand tools. This makes it a convenient option for momentary and fast solutions. In contrast, warm mix asphalt demands a more fancy installment process. It entails heating the mix to high temperature levels before laying it down on an appropriately ready base. The preparation includes compacting the base, using a tack layer, and utilizing heavy equipment like pavers and compactors for a long lasting and smooth surface. When thinking about asphalt options, durability and longevity are crucial variables to evaluate for long-term pavement efficiency. Hot mix asphalt (HMA) is recognized for its extraordinary resilience and durability. The high temperature levels during the mixing and laying process enable much better compaction, leading to a denser and more powerful pavement structure. This brings about HMA being much more resistant to hefty website traffic lots, severe climate condition, and the effects old compared to cool mix asphalt (CMA)
In terms of cold mix asphalt long life, HMA generally outmatches CMA due to its premium strength and resistance residential properties. HMA pavements have a longer life span, requiring much less constant fixings and maintenance, which can convert to set you back financial savings in the lengthy run. In addition, HMA sidewalks are much more conveniently adjustable to fulfill specific job needs, even more boosting their toughness.
